Some of the notable features of KakaoTalk Messenger are that it's unlimited, global, and available on iOS, Android, and Blackberry. You can send texts, pictures, and video, as well as voice notes. It distinguishes itself from an app like Apple's Messages with additional features, like the ability to change the background image and exporting your conversations to email. The app is similar to the popular WhatsApp Messenger, but it is currently free.
